Composed by Jennifer Hodge. Arranged by Jennifer Hodge. This edition: pdf. Christmas, Religious, Traditional. Score. 5 pages. Jennifer Hodge #1305153. Published by Jennifer Hodge (A0.1744345).

This is an easy intermediate level medley of traditional Christmas hymns arranged for two flutes. The songs include: O Come, O Come Emmanuel, It Came Upon A Midnight Clear, Hark! The Herald Angels Sing, O Holy Night, and Silent Night.
